WT7238
The WT7238 is a capable of driving up to four high constant current outputs. The controller can be via I2C interface control the LED dimming function. The IC provides the user with over temperature protection and LED open/short function. The IC has high accurate current drivers with a minimized current mismatch among LED strings.
Features
- Supports I2C protocol dimming control
- Supports I2C Brightness control mode 256 step dimming control
- Output voltage from Input voltage to 60V
- 4-channel constant current output
- Auto setting the step-up controller regulates output just above the highest LED string voltage
- ±3% regulates string current accuracy and ±6% between ICs
- Output current set by an external resistor (range: 150 to 350mA per channel)
- LED open/short protection
- Over-Temperature protection
- Under-Voltage protection
- Low Standby Current
- Package type :16-pin SOP with exposed pad, Green package
